The History of Indian Dal Golden Lentil Soup

The Origins of Lentils in Indian Cuisine

Lentils have been a staple in Indian cuisine for thousands of years, with evidence of their consumption dating back to the Indus Valley Civilization. They were a popular crop due to their ability to grow in a variety of climates and their nutritional value. It is believed that lentils were introduced to India by traders from the Middle East, and since then, they have become an integral part of Indian cuisine.

The Significance of Dal in Indian Culture

Dal, which refers to any split pulse or legume, is an essential component of Indian cuisine. It is a rich source of protein, making it an excellent choice for vegetarians and vegans. In addition to its nutritional value, dal also holds cultural significance in India. It is commonly served as a side dish or as the main component of a meal, and is often prepared during religious ceremonies and festivals.

The Recipe for Indian Dal Golden Lentil Soup

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up yellow split lentils (moong dal)
  • 3 cups water
  • 1 tablespoon ghee or vegetable oil
  • 1 teaspoon cumin seeds
  • 1 on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 inch ginger, grated
  • 1 tomato, chopped
  • 1 teaspoon turmeric powder
  • 1 teaspoon coriander powder
  • 1 teaspoon cumin powder
  • Salt to taste
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• Fresh coriander leaves for garnish

Instructions:

  1. Rinse the lentils under running water until the water runs clear.
  2. In a pot, add the lentils and water and bring to a boil. Reduce the heat and let it simmer for about 20 minutes, until the lentils are soft and mushy.
  3. In a separate pan, heat ghee or oil over medium heat. Add cumin seeds and let them splutter.
  4. Add the chopped onions, garlic, and ginger and sauté until the onions are translucent.
  5. Add the chopped tomato and cook until it becomes soft.
  6. Add turmeric powder, coriander powder, and cumin powder and cook for a minute.
  7. Add this mixture to the pot of cooked lentils and mix well.
  8. Add salt to taste and let it simmer for another 5 minutes.
  9. Stir in lemon juice and remove from heat.
  10. Garnish with fresh coriander leaves and serve hot with rice or bread.
